episode #32 — Player Development and Leadership ft. Tarrik Brock artwork

#32 — Player Development and Leadership ft. Tarrik Brock

Baseball development goes far beyond mechanics and talent. The best coaches understand how to teach, communicate, and help players grow both on and off the field. In this episode, host Matt Rossignol is joined by Tarrik Brock, Pittsburgh Pirates 1st Base Coach and Baserunning Coach, to discuss his journey through professional baseball and what he has learned from years of playing and coaching at the highest level. The conversation covers player development, baserunning, leadership, and the importance of building relationships with athletes. Tarrik shares insights from training under Reggie Smith, working with players like Giancarlo Stanton and Christian Yelich, and why great coaching is about more than just giving information. They also dive into mindset, routines, youth development, and what separates players who continue to grow from those who stay stuck. episode #29 — Should You Play Summer Ball? artwork

#29 — Should You Play Summer Ball?

Summer is one of the most important times of the year for player development, but many athletes struggle to use it the right way. In this episode, host Matt Rossignol breaks down how players should approach summer and whether summer ball is the right fit based on their goals and current development. He discusses how to evaluate where you are, what is holding you back, and how to make decisions that move you closer to your next level. The conversation dives into the tradeoffs between playing games and focusing on development, including the impact of travel, inconsistent training, and nutrition. Matt explains why some athletes need to prioritize strength, size, and skill work instead of simply chasing innings or at bats. This episode emphasizes being honest with yourself, identifying your limiting factors, and committing fully to the path that best supports your goals.
